Senior Technical Analyst
Location:
WestPoint/Rahway, USA
The Senior Technical Analyst will be responsible for supporting configuration, build, validation, & release activities for the successful release of a global enterprise Agilent OpenLAB CDS 2.x platform (OL:CDS), supporting and managing lab deployment resources in Agilent Instrument Controllers (AIC) builds, deployments, & troubleshooting efforts, and oversight of post-release operational/support activities. Core responsibilities include:
- Assist technical lead with OL:
CDS platform Clienthitecture design. - Request and configure AWS cloud resources for OL:
CDS platform Clienthitecture and business work flow requirements. - Manage daily/weekly activities of the OL:
CDS deployment resources. - Primary point of contact and technical support for the OL:
CDS deployment resources (Acronis PC image build and use for AIC PCs, AIC deployment troubleshooting, and instrument connection troubleshooting). - Coordination of activities with project core team to ensure AIC's are deployable according to lab migration plan.
- Responsible for authoring/execution of all requirement test scripts and SDLC documentation is completed.
- Interact with project core and extended teams, attending meetings as necessary.
Required skills/experience:
- Direct experience with Microsoft & AWS products, services, infrastructure.
- 5+ years of experience configuring and supporting Agilent OpenLAB CDS 2.x platforms, including troubleshooting instrument & software connection issues.
- Strong understanding of supporting chromatography data systems with 400+ users and instruments in a pharmaceutical R&D space (GxP & non-GxP).
- Demonstrated supervisory experience of small teams.
- Proven experience with upgrading chromatography data systems in a regulated environment.
- Experience developing IQ/OQ test cases and supporting testers through UAT.
- Excellent written and verbal communication skills — able to explain technical configuration decisions to both technical and non-technical audiences.
- Ability to travel to Rahway and/or West Point, as necessary, for on-site efforts.
- Proven success producing IQ/OQ documentation and training materials, conducting 1:1 and group training sessions.
- Previous experience using Confluence, JIRA, Xray/Vera, and Service Now are a plus.
